Output 5ac00aebf79c8dc4339f5b074a5fe4af857c93adca0bc9e64e07d1c43fcee426:8

value
340448371
script pubkey
OP_0 OP_PUSHBYTES_20 b3498f61a6a43905ddf350c04835e0bbb87486bc
address
bc1qkdyc7cdx5susth0n2rqysd0qhwu8fp4urs9efc
transaction
5ac00aebf79c8dc4339f5b074a5fe4af857c93adca0bc9e64e07d1c43fcee426
confirmations
229171
spent
true